About This Opportunity

The Department of Veterans Affairs is procuring short-term maintenance and support services for the existing patient/guest Wi-Fi network at the Baltimore, Loch Raven, and Perry Point VA Medical Centers. The scope includes full lifecycle operational support, including maintenance, remote administration, monitoring, outage response, dedicated bandwidth management, incident reporting, and configuration sustainment.
